Quick Assessment

This early reader book introduces foundational math concepts such as numbers, shapes, sizes, and sorting, aligned with pre-K and kindergarten standards. Its simple text paired with vivid illustrations supports young children aged 5 to 8 as they develop early math skills and prepare for more advanced learning. The content is gentle and appropriate for early learners beginning their math journey.
